Mrs. Ola Ann Screws, 86, of Grovetown passed away peacefully on April 21, 2026.
A gifted artist, Ola’s hands wove beauty through the delicate craft of crocheting. She lovingly crafted baby blankets and clothes, each stitch imbued with the tender care that characterized her entire being. She enjoyed gardening and tending to her greenhouse, her yard always looking beautiful with plants and flowers. Her home echoed with the joyful sounds of music and dancing, emblematic of a soul that celebrated life with a vibrant passion. Family gatherings, especially those at Easter and Christmas, were her cherished moments, where her loving presence blessed every occasion.
Ola was the embodiment of a loving and forgiving nature—an enduring pillar of strength as a beloved and devoted wife, mother, grandmother, and great-grandmother. Even Pastor Chad affectionately called her "Grandma," a reflection of her nurturing spirit extending beyond her immediate family. She was a caretaker in the truest sense, always attentive to the needs of others, pouring her heart and soul into everything she undertook.
She leaves behind her beloved children: Elizabeth Walker and her husband Philip, Carrel Best and her husband Jerry, and Jerome Screws; along with eight grandchildren and fourteen great-grandchildren. Ola’s legacy also lives on through numerous cousins and other extended family members who were touched by her grace and generosity.
Ola was preceded in death by her cherished parents, Hubert and Carrel Gnann; her devoted husband, Ted H. Screws Sr.; and her sons, Jeff Screws and Teddy Screws Jr. Their memories rest forever intertwined with hers in the tapestry of love she so carefully created.
Funeral Services will be held at 11:00 AM Monday, April 27, 2026 in the Thomas L. King Funeral Home Chapel with Rev. Chad Widener officiating. The family will recieve friends one hour prior to the service from 10 until 11 at the funeral home. Interment will follow at Bellevue Memorial Gardens.
